USC Notes: Can Sir Lincoln Of Riley Pony Up A Donation?

Jen Cohen stated today that USC has raised $174 million of its $225 million goal for the construction of the new football facility and Dedeaux Field. Cohen said two additional donors recently donated $5 million or more to the project. Has Lincoln Riley made a donation of any note to this project that he demanded? Morning Buzz: A Relief for USC Staff In Recruiting

Some USC staffers are breathing a sigh of relief with Chad Bowden in charge of recruiting. Why? Because Lincoln Riley had told at least one staff member that he did not want big-name players from the past coming to recruiting events. No one relished the idea of telling some USC legend their services were not required for recruiting.
